The Lyon Arboretum in Manoa Valley will now be open for visitors on Saturday. 9 a.m.–3 p.m. For the past several years, the arboretum has been open to the public only during weekdays, limiting its accessibility to the community and to families who cannot visit during the week.
The arboretum is a 193-acre tropical rainforest located in the head of the Manoa Valley and is open to the public. Its mission is to increase the appreciation of the unique flora of Hawai'i and the tropics, by conserving, curating and studying plants and their habitats; providing inclusive educational opportunities; encouraging use by the broader community; and supporting the educational, scientific and service activities of the University of Hawai'i.
